Abstract
586,682. Condensers. SPORING, P. A., and TELEGRAPH CONDENSER CO., Ltd. May 8, 1944, No. 8682. [Class 37] A tubular container 7 for an electric condenser 1 or other apparatus is closed at one or both ends by spinning over the edge 8 to grip a resilient disc 5 between the edge and some portion of the enclosed apparatus. In one example, Fig. 2, the resilient discs 5 bear on discs 9 of, e.g., " Bakelite " (Registered Trade Mark), one of which bears against an internal beading or series of projections 10 and the other against the edge of a ceramic cup 1. The discs 5 are of natural or synthetic rubber, e.g., neoprene, and have central bosses 6 to ensure efficient sealing of wire leads 3. The spun-over edge 8 makes an angle of about 45 with the axis of the tube to enhance the grip of the discs on the wires 3. The ceramic cup has internal and external metallic coatings, only the latter, 2, being visible in the drawing, and the wires 3 are soldered to the coatings, as at 4. In another example, Fig. 1 (not shown), the edges of the container are spun over at right-angles to grip the margin of the resilient discs against a ceramic dielectric plate. In a rolled condenser the wire lead may be formed into a spiral which forms a bearing surface for a resilient disc. The container is preferably made of aluminium in the case of electrolytic condensers, but is otherwise brass &c. which is advantageous when one end of the container is closed except for a small hole in which the wire lead is soldered. If a resilient disc is employed at each'end, one disc may be made conductive by incorporating in it a conductive powder as so to effect electrical connection between the wire and container. The container may be spun over at one end prior to the insertion of the apparatus. The discs may be coloured &c. to distinguish polarity in the case of electrolytic condensers &c.
